4

我正在尝试使用开放的 Bloomberg API 来收集特定日期特定时间范围内的 VWAP 交易量。例如,如何获取 8 月 27 日上午 11 点到 11:15 之间的 VWAP_VOLUME?

使用 Excel,我可以使用

BDP("MSFT US Equity", "VWAP_VOLUME", "VWAP_START_TIME=11:00:00", "VWAP_END_TIME=11:15:00", "VWAP_START_DT=20120827", "VWAP_END_DT=20120827")

因为我可以在 Excel 中完成,所以我应该能够在 Java 中做同样的事情。我尝试使用 ReferenceDataRequest 覆盖日期和时间字段。我还尝试使用带有在时间字段上设置的覆盖的 HistoricalDataRequest。两者都不返回任何数据。我怎样才能做到这一点?

4

1 回答 1

1

你在哪个时区?我在英国,如果我使用 15:00 作为开始时间并使用 15:15 作为结束时间(我的参数为 0),它适用于我,并使用以下元素,使用“ReferenceDataRequest”:

  • 证券:MSFT US Equity
  • 字段:VWAP_VOLUME
  • 覆盖:
    • fieldId=VWAP_START_TIME:值=15:00:00
    • fieldId=VWAP_END_TIME:值=15:15:00
    • fieldId=VWAP_START_DT:值=20120827
    • fieldId=VWAP_END_DT:值=20120827
于 2012-09-04T16:10:15.127 回答